RECORD RUN-GETTER
DULEEPSINHJI PILES SCORE UP FOR SUSSEX TEAM United P.A.—By Telegraph—Copyright Reed. 10.50 a.m. LONDON, Friday. T>LAYING against Northants, Duleepsinhji 'compiled the highest score ever put up for Sussex, eclipsing Ranjitsinhji’s 285 against Somerset in 1901. He batted faultlessly for five and a-half hours for 333 runs, which included one six and 34 fours.
